NBCUniversal is looking for a Manager, Staging Operations to join our Rockefeller Center Operations team in New York City! In this role, you will be responsible for:

  • Managing all day to day staging (carpentry, props, electric and special effects) needs in a 24/7 live and taped studio production environment
  • Responding to studio issues with urgency
  • Functioning as the on-site supervisor for all studio IATSE stage employees, USA scenic designers and scenic artists within the NY studios. Support facilities and ensure studio is safe, clean, and maintained.
  • Working closely with show tech managers and Staging Director to troubleshoot issues related to set construction and design
  • Setting crew schedules for each week
  • Oversight of AM/PM crews
  • Managing staffing of employees via Storm

Qualifications

  • BA/BS preferred
  • Minimum 5 years working experience in a studio production environment
  • Minimum of 3 years of management experience required
  • Must have strong working knowledge in set construction, studio lighting systems, and managing remote productions
  • Must have excellent client relationships
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
  • Working knowledge of IATSE and USA union contracts and work closely with labor relations.
  • Must be willing to work in New York
  • Must have unrestricted work authorization to work in the United States
  • Must be 18 years or older.
  • Must be able to work in a fast paced, changing, team-oriented environment and possess a “hands on” management style.
  • Must be able to work all hours including weekends and overnights and be available 24/7 if needed.
  • Manager will be required to be onsite throughout production times
  • Excellent management skills with a demonstrated track record for meeting timelines and delivering results.
